Rupee's defence takes RBI dollar shorts to a record high

The Indian rupee has appreciated from its record low of 96.96 per dollar on May 20 to close at 94.66 on Tuesday, supported by multiple RBI interventions that prevented it from breaching the 97 mark. The central bank's dollar short positions have risen to a record high as it defends the currency. Market participants expect 40-70 billion dollars in capital inflows via the ECB and FCNR(B) schemes, which the RBI is likely to use to retire its net short forward book and rebuild reserves from the current 672 billion dollars toward its earlier peak of 728 billion dollars.
